汪微的博客
zane,做一个有思维的开发者

汪微的博客

LINUX系统下安装nginx

2017年08月28日118 browse

网上有很多的教程安装nginx,本文章也主要是记录nginx安装过程(仅供参考):

下载解压包(以1.59版本为例)

$ cd /usr/src
$ wget http://nginx.org/download/nginx-1.12.0.tar.gz

解压压缩包

$ tar xvf nginx-1.12.0.tar.gz

设置配置

$ cd nginx-1.12.0

普通安装

$ ./configure --prefix=/usr/local/nginx

安装SSL模块(支持https)

./configure --prefix=/usr/local/nginx --with-http_stub_status_module --with-http_ssl_module

安装HTTP2.0模块

查看openssl版本

openssl version -a

如果版本小于1.0.2版本则从新下载安装

wget https://www.openssl.org/source/openssl-1.1.0e.tar.gz
tar xvf openssl-1.1.0e.tar.gz

安装

./configure --prefix=/usr/local/nginx --with-http_stub_status_module --with-http_ssl_module --with-http_realip_module --with-http_v2_module --with-openssl=../openssl-1.1.0e

安装依赖

$ yum -y install pcre-devel openssl openssl-devel

编译安装nginx

$ make
$ make install

安装完毕启动nginx

$ /usr/local/nginx/sbin/nginx

常用nginx操作命令

//查询nginx主进程号
$ ps -ef | grep nginx

//从容停止Nginx:
$kill -QUIT 主进程号

//快速停止Nginx:
kill -TERM 主进程号

//强制停止Nginx:
pkill -9 nginx


自此nginx安装完毕!

博主 zane 发表于 2017-08-28 20:10:21,添加在了 nginx 标签下

打赏

您的支持将鼓励我继续努力与分享。

扫码打赏,建议金额1-10元

提醒:打赏金额将直接进此方账号,无法退款,请您谨慎操作。

评论

正在加载验证码......

提交

555

2018-03-05 08:53:41